About This Activity

This Week's Challenge Theme: Get motivated for this week’s challenge theme, as you consider how to inspire others to care about a cause you believe in. Each team will work to design graphics, shoot b-roll, compose music, and record narration to compile an effective public awareness video. Put your creativity and imagination to the test, while developing basic filmmaking skills as a team. Every Week: Welcome to Wildwood Academy’s Splash n’ Create Summer Camps — where every day includes creative blends of art and design challenges paired with outdoor games and water-based summer fun! In our summer in motion series, campers explore the question: How can we film, edit, and produce innovative, musical, funny, or creative movies? Campers will plan, shoot, and edit a variety of movie projects while building hands-on and digital skills. From set and prop design to special effects, music and B-roll editing, campers will get a taste of what it takes to make a film! This blending of creative and analytical skills is mixed with the staples of Splash n’ Create Summer Camps: community games throughout the day, water play, and swimming opportunities throughout the week–all of this on top of weekly field trips and contributions to summer-long citizen science projects. Students will assist with animal track plates, plant surveys, and water quality samples to track data needed for a “Changemakers project” in the last week of summer camp.
